1. Flexibility in Learning
One of the greatest advantages of online learning is the ability to learn anytime, anywhere. Unlike traditional classrooms bound by schedules, online platforms give learners the freedom to study at their own pace. This flexibility is especially beneficial for working professionals and students balancing multiple responsibilities.
2. Access to Global Resources
Online education breaks geographical barriers. Learners in any part of the world can now access courses from prestigious institutions, expert tutors, and specialized programs. This global reach not only broadens academic opportunities but also fosters exposure to different cultures, teaching methods, and perspectives.
3. Cost-Effective Education
Traditional education often comes with high tuition fees, accommodation expenses, and travel costs. Online learning reduces these barriers, offering affordable programs without compromising quality. Many platforms even provide free or low-cost courses, making education more inclusive.
4. Personalized Learning Experience
With features like recorded lectures, adaptive assessments, and AI-based recommendations, online platforms allow students to customize their learning journey. Each learner can focus more on their weak areas and progress faster in their strengths, creating a personalized pathway to success.
5. Skill Development for the Future
Online courses are often designed to focus on practical, industry-relevant skills. From coding and data science to communication and leadership, learners can directly prepare for careers in emerging industries. This skill-based approach makes online learning especially valuable in today’s job market.
6. Promoting Self-Discipline and Accountability
While the flexibility of online learning is a strength, it also develops essential life skills. Learners must manage their time, stay motivated, and take responsibility for their progress—traits that are equally important for professional and personal success.

Is online learning suitable for all subjects?
Yes. While it excels in theoretical subjects like math, science, and language, practical or lab-based subjects may require hybrid approaches. Many platforms now provide simulations or virtual labs to bridge this gap.
